Speaking of upgraded AE...I am SO happy with OSS unmitza V4. I've had them about 6 months and they don't overheat or throw error codes in the summertime here like the Lux do. They look really good in person. Side by side they look nearly identical to the LCI E92 LED AE. It was a bit pricey for lighting...and took nearly a month since ground shipping to and from Miami takes forever. I still have no regrets.
